From grapefruitopia.
To install, just unzip it, copy the clock folder to your storage card, and create a shortcut from the SpeakingClock.exe file to your start menu. Note that in this current version, the sounds have to be in \Storage Card\clock\ else it won't find them (if the clock just makes beeping noises, then that's why) There is also an alternative American female voice. I've uploaded both together with a readme file. |
